Core Viewpoint - The article highlights the journey of Chengdu Runlong Electric Co., Ltd., a small enterprise that has become a leading manufacturer of drying filters in China and globally, emphasizing its innovative approaches and resilience in the face of competition from international giants like Haier [1][4][26]. Company Overview - Chengdu Runlong Electric Co., Ltd. has grown over 30 years to become the market leader in drying filters in China and ranks among the top globally [1]. - The company was founded by Huang Yingli in 1995, initially as Chengdu Longquan Refrigeration Component Factory, focusing on a critical component of refrigeration systems [4][11]. Product Significance - Drying filters play a crucial role in refrigeration systems by filtering impurities and moisture, ensuring the longevity and efficiency of refrigerators [1][8]. - The design of drying filters includes a copper shell and a high-efficiency molecular sieve to effectively remove contaminants from refrigerants [8]. Technological Advancements - The company transitioned from outdated hot-rolling technology to cold-extrusion technology, significantly improving product quality and meeting stringent standards set by major clients like Haier [9][11]. - This shift not only enhanced the aesthetic and cleanliness of the products but also positioned Runlong as a competitive player in the market [11]. Market Position and Strategy - Runlong's dedication to meeting Haier's high standards led to its recognition as Haier's Best Quality Supplier in 1998, marking a significant milestone in its growth [11][12]. - The company adopted a diversification strategy to reduce dependency on a single client, enhancing its resilience against market fluctuations [15]. Industry Impact - By 2008, Runlong was designated as the leading unit for the national standard GB/T 23135-2008 for drying filters, showcasing its evolution from a follower to a rule-maker in the industry [18]. - The company has developed a rapid response system for customized solutions, catering to high-end markets such as vaccine cold chains and aerospace [17][18]. Competitive Edge - Runlong has built a competitive barrier through over 20 core patents and a focus on high-end customization, distinguishing itself from competitors who primarily engage in mass production [20]. - The company's commitment to quality, rooted in military standards, has established a strong reputation and customer trust [15][22].
